Output 73b6d01f2821dcfe3f7a34a3909be9d247571dfdcf1cbfe76978330c19ee974e:34

value
189628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63393c44993280e37b3b0c53e973aacc5af093c OP_EQUAL
address
3Q8owP6EHpbcmquSCRx2goVaKExYAokHe8
transaction
73b6d01f2821dcfe3f7a34a3909be9d247571dfdcf1cbfe76978330c19ee974e
confirmations
563338
spent
true